Personal Demon is the 8th book in the 'Women of the Otherworld' series and this time Hope Adams is the main character. Anyone who has been following this series knows Hope Adams from the previous books. She is a tabloid journalist and half demon who has inherited a hunger for chaos from her father.

In this new addition to the series we see Hope going undercover for Benicio Cortez. He has some problems with a small gang of supernaturals and wants her to check things out. Things seem simple at first but then Hope realises that she has stumbled into something a little more complicated than a simple job gathering information.

Of course this was a great read like every other book in this series. However I have to admit that Hope isn't my favourite character. I also don't like Karl very much so it was quite annoying that they both played such a big part in this story. What I found refreshing was the chapters written from Lucas Cortez's (Paige's husband) point of view.

If you are a fan of this series get hold of this book soon and devour it! If you haven't even tried this series yet then go find 'Bitten' and get hooked ;)
